Output 634631ca3257dfd0cefa11e686ea1746c495c729331c59200f6951d273e87f27:12

value
41614546
script pubkey
OP_0 OP_PUSHBYTES_20 41c6c1c5baac3bcb892f6705571661963dd8f2dd
address
bc1qg8rvr3d64sauhzf0vuz4w9npjc7a3ukalzj5k3
transaction
634631ca3257dfd0cefa11e686ea1746c495c729331c59200f6951d273e87f27
confirmations
2420
spent
true